What is a JV 100?
Juvenile Dependency Petition (Version One) (JV-100) The social worker uses this to start a case in juvenile dependency court. Get form JV-100.
What is the Judicial Council of California?
The Judicial Council is the policymaking body of the California courts, the largest court system in the nation.
